Summary

Oregon Ducks secured a spot in the Super Regionals by sweeping the Eugene Regional. They defeated Yale, Washington State, and rival Oregon State to advance for the third time in four years. They will face No. 6 seed Texas in Austin, with the first game scheduled for Saturday at 5 p.m. PT. The Ducks are currently ranked fifth among the remaining teams after the regional play, as they aim for their first trip to the College World Series in modern program history.
